Sympathy to Terri Hord Owens (1999) on the death of her mother, Alice Darlene Harris Hord, on September 12. She was 80. As Terri wrote, "She was a woman of grace, kindness and always attentive to propriety in every situation." She was a dedicated member of Light of the World Christian Church (Disciples of Christ) in Indianapolis for over 40 years, serving as a deacon, secretary of the church council, administrator of Heaven on Earth Ministries and executive assistant to Dr. Tom Benjamin, a position she held for 15 years after taking her own early retirement from IBM. She was the resident church historian and managed the catalog of Bishop Benjamin’s sermons and tapes, seeing the value of these recordings as part of LWCC’s church history. More here.

Kenneth "Kenny" Azel Bloyd (1992) died on July 7, 2021, in Canton, Illinois. He was 64. After working for Mid-Century Telephone Co-Op for nearly two decades, he went back to school, earning a BA from Eureka College in 1992, and then the dual MDiv and MA in SSA from the University of Chicago as a Disciples Divinity House Scholar. His career in ministry, chaplaincy, and social work was centered in his home town of Canton and the surrounding community, including as youth minister at Sunnyland Christian Church, minister at Cuba Christian Church, LCSW and chaplain at Graham Hospital, minister at First Congregational UCC in Canton, Psychotherapy Department Manager at Mason District Hospital, and currently, chaplain at Spoon River Correctional Center. He is survived by two sons, Nathan and Kyle (Alicia) Bloyd; ten grandchildren and four great-grandchildren; his mother; and his partner, Geneva Becker. He was preceded in death by his son Jeremy.
